Feature | Fujifilm X T4 | Sony Alpha A6500 |
---|---|---|
Sensor Type | APS-C | APS-C |
Megapixels | 26.1 MP | 24.2 MP |
Image Stabilization | In-body | In-body |
ISO Range | 160-12800 (expandable to 80-51200) | 100-25600 (expandable to 51200) |
Autofocus Points | 425 | 425 |
Continuous Shooting Speed | Up to 15 fps | Up to 11 fps |
Video Resolution | 4K UHD 60p | 4K UHD 30p |
Viewfinder Type | Electronic | Electronic |
Viewfinder Resolution | 3.69 million dots | 2.36 million dots |
Screen Type | Tilting touchscreen LCD | Tilting touchscreen LCD |
Screen Size | 3 inches | 3 inches |
Wireless Connectivity | Wi-Fi, Bluetooth | Wi-Fi, NFC |
Battery Life | Approx. 500 shots | Approx. 350 shots |
Dimensions | 134.6 x 92.8 x 63.8 mm | 120 x 66.9 x 53.3 mm |
Weight | 607g (including battery and memory card) | 453g (including battery and memory card) |
